What is a Socket Weld Tee?
A Socket Weld Tee is a pipe fitting designed with a socket or recessed area to accommodate the insertion of a pipe. This creates a strong, leak-proof joint when welded properly. The tee is used to branch off pipelines at a 90-degree angle, allowing for three connection points.
Socket Weld Tees are available in various materials, sizes, and pressure ratings, catering to the needs of industries like oil and gas, petrochemicals, power generation, and more.

Types of Socket Weld Tee
At Emirerri Steel, we offer a variety of ASME B16.11 Socket Weld Tees to meet diverse industrial requirements. The primary types include:
- Equal Tee (Straight Tee):
- Features three outlets of the same size.
- Commonly used to distribute fluid evenly in pipelines.
- Reducing Tee:
- Has one outlet with a smaller diameter than the other two.
- Ideal for reducing the flow or combining different pipe sizes.

Materials Used in ASME B16.11 Socket Weld Tee
Socket Weld Tees are manufactured from various materials to ensure compatibility with different applications. Some common materials include:
- Stainless Steel
- Grades: 304, 304L, 316, 316L
- Features: High resistance to corrosion, durability, and excellent performance in extreme environments.
- Carbon Steel
- Grades: ASTM A105, A106
- Features: High strength and cost-effectiveness for standard applications.
- Alloy Steel
- Grades: ASTM A182 F5, F9, F11, F22
- Features: Superior strength and heat resistance for high-temperature applications.
- Duplex & Super Duplex Steel
- Grades: UNS S31803, S32750
- Features: Exceptional corrosion resistance and high mechanical strength.
- Nickel Alloys
- Grades: Inconel, Monel, Hastelloy
- Features: Outstanding performance in highly corrosive environments.

Dimensions and Pressure Ratings
Socket Weld Tees are manufactured in a range of dimensions and pressure ratings to cater to various industrial needs.
- Pressure Classes:
- Available in Class 2000, 3000, 6000, and 9000, depending on the operating conditions.
- Dimensions:
- Sizes range from ½ inch to 4 inches.
- Precise dimensions are specified in the ASME B16.11 standard, ensuring uniformity and compatibility.
